Motorcycle Controls

  • Left to Right
    • Clutch: Kills power to the rear wheel when pulled
    • Blinkers
    • Horn
    • Key
    • Kill switch
    • Power button
    • Throttle
    • Front Brake: Provides 70% of stopping power
  • Down and Other Side
    • Shifter:
      • Upshift by kicking up
      • Downshift by kicking down
    • Rear Brake: Provides 30% of stopping power

Getting on the Bike

  • Approach from the kickstand side
  • Grab handlebars
  • Swing right leg over
  • Straighten bike and wheel
  • Put the kickstand up

Starting the Bike

  1. Turn the key to ignition
  2. Turn off the kill switch
  3. Ensure the bike is in neutral
  4. Press the power button

Engaging the Friction Zone

  • Pull in the clutch and kick down into first gear
  • Slowly let out the clutch and give throttle
  • Practice is key to mastering the friction zone
  • Avoid killing the bike by letting out the clutch too fast

Riding

  1. Feet Up and Ride
    • After engaging the friction zone, put feet up and ride
    • Begin in first gear at approximately 5 mph
  2. Using Throttle
    • Roll on the throttle by twisting right hand
    • Feeds gas to the bike to increase speed

Shifting Gears

  1. Upshift (e.g., from 1st to 2nd)
    • Roll off throttle
    • Pull in the clutch
    • Kick up on shifter
    • Let out clutch and give throttle
  2. Downshift (e.g., from 2nd to 1st)
    • Roll off throttle
    • Pull in clutch
    • Kick down on shifter
    • Slowly release clutch

Stopping the Bike

  • Use both brakes:
    • 70% front brake
    • 30% rear brake (avoid skidding)
  • Pull in clutch to kill power to back wheel
  • Come to a controlled stop, put left foot down
  • Optional: Keep right foot on rear brake or put it down

Turning Off the Bike

  1. Hit the kill switch
  2. Pull in clutch
  3. Half-click up on shifter to neutral
  4. Let out clutch
  5. Put kickstand down
  6. Lean handlebars left and dismount
